Selecting the Right Planetary System



When it involves choosing the appropriate solar system for your home, where do you start? First, consider your energy requires. Evaluation your past utility expenses to establish just how much power you eat.

Next off, think about the system type that matches your way of life: grid-tied, off-grid, or hybrid. Grid-tied systems are prominent for their cost-effectiveness, while off-grid systems use independence.

After that, assess the solar panel kinds-- monocrystalline, polycrystalline, or thin-film-- based on performance and spending plan.

Don't forget to consider your roofing's positioning and shading, as these affect system efficiency.

Finally, study reputable solar installers in your area, read evaluations, and request quotes. Selecting the best system sets the structure for your solar journey and future energy financial savings.

Financing Your Solar Setup



While browsing the path to solar power, understanding your funding choices is essential for making an educated decision. You have actually got a few choices to think about: cash acquisitions, finances, and leases.

If you can pay ahead of time, you'll conserve the most gradually. Nonetheless, if cash flow is a problem, solar loans can assist spread out the price over a number of years while still enabling you to gain from motivations.



Leasing provides a low upfront cost however may restrict your financial savings. Don't forget about available tax obligation credit scores and refunds that can substantially reduce your total expense.
